1. Advanced Imaging and Diagnostics:
- High-resolution imaging: This encompasses advancements in medical imaging (MRI, CT scans, ultrasound) offering unprecedented detail and clarity for diagnosis and treatment planning. The ability to visualize minuscule details improves accuracy and effectiveness in healthcare.
- AI-powered image analysis: Artificial intelligence is transforming medical imaging by automating analysis, detecting anomalies with greater accuracy than human eyes alone, and assisting in faster, more precise diagnoses. This is particularly crucial in areas like cancer detection and ophthalmology.
- Optical coherence tomography (OCT): This non-invasive imaging technique provides high-resolution cross-sectional images of tissues, particularly valuable in ophthalmology for diagnosing retinal diseases and managing glaucoma.
2. Augmented and Virtual Reality (AR/VR):
- Immersive experiences: AR/VR technologies are creating increasingly realistic and interactive visual environments, transforming gaming, education, training simulations, and even therapy. The level of detail and responsiveness continues to improve, creating truly immersive experiences.
- Head-mounted displays (HMDs): Advancements in HMD technology are improving resolution, comfort, and portability, making AR/VR more accessible and user-friendly.
- Haptic feedback: Combining visual enhancements with tactile feedback creates a more complete and realistic immersive experience, crucial for training simulations and interactive entertainment.
3. Display Technologies:
- MicroLED and OLED displays: These technologies are pushing the boundaries of screen resolution, color accuracy, contrast ratio, and energy efficiency, resulting in sharper, more vibrant, and power-saving displays in various applications, from smartphones and televisions to automotive dashboards.
- Holographic displays: While still evolving, holographic displays promise to revolutionize how we interact with visual information, creating three-dimensional images without the need for special glasses.
4. Visual Aids and Corrective Technologies:
- Smart contact lenses: These are being developed to incorporate features like glucose monitoring, eye pressure tracking, and even augmented reality overlays.
- Advanced eye surgery techniques: Minimally invasive surgical procedures are constantly improving, offering more precise corrections for refractive errors and other vision impairments.
